Tin Bronze Filter Element

Updated: 2026-07-25

Overview

Tin bronze filter elements are specialized filtration components made from tin bronze alloys, typically containing around 6% tin (CuSn6). These filter elements are designed to withstand harsh industrial environments while providing reliable filtration performance. They are commonly used in hydraulic systems, fuel filtration, and other applications where corrosion resistance and durability are critical. Tin bronze's unique properties make it an ideal material for filter elements in demanding conditions. The alloy offers excellent resistance to wear, corrosion, and fatigue, ensuring long service life even in challenging operating environments. These characteristics make tin bronze filter elements particularly valuable in marine, petroleum, and chemical processing industries.

Structure and Working Principle

Tin bronze filter elements typically feature a porous structure created through sintering or other manufacturing processes. This structure allows fluid to pass through while trapping contaminants of specified sizes. The pore size and distribution can be precisely controlled during manufacturing to achieve different filtration grades. The working principle involves fluid passing through the porous bronze matrix, where particles larger than the pore size are captured. The tortuous path through the material ensures effective filtration while maintaining reasonable flow rates. Some designs incorporate multiple layers or gradients of porosity to enhance filtration efficiency and dirt-holding capacity.

Key Features

The primary advantages of tin bronze filter elements include exceptional corrosion resistance, particularly in seawater and chemical environments. This makes them superior to standard brass or stainless steel filters in many applications. They also exhibit good thermal conductivity and can withstand relatively high temperatures. Another significant feature is their mechanical strength and resistance to pressure surges common in hydraulic systems. Unlike some polymer-based filters, tin bronze elements maintain their structural integrity under high pressure and vibration conditions. Additionally, they can be cleaned and reused multiple times, offering cost savings over disposable filter alternatives.

Application Areas

Tin bronze filter elements find extensive use in marine engineering for seawater filtration systems, where their corrosion resistance is particularly valuable. They are also common in hydraulic power units for industrial machinery, mobile equipment, and aircraft systems. The petroleum industry utilizes these filters for fuel and lubricating oil filtration. Other applications include chemical processing plants, power generation facilities, and compressed air systems. Their ability to handle both liquid and gas filtration makes them versatile components across multiple industrial sectors.

Maintenance and Precautions

Proper maintenance of tin bronze filter elements involves regular inspection and cleaning to prevent excessive pressure drop across the filter. Cleaning typically involves backflushing with appropriate solvents or ultrasonic cleaning for thorough contaminant removal. Precautions include avoiding exposure to strong acids or alkalis that could damage the bronze material. It's important to monitor pressure differentials across the filter as increasing pressure drop indicates the need for cleaning or replacement. Storage should be in dry conditions to prevent oxidation when not in use.

B2B Procurement Guide

When procuring tin bronze filter elements, buyers should specify the exact alloy composition (typically CuSn6), pore size (in microns), dimensions, and pressure ratings. Consider flow rate requirements and compatibility with the fluid medium in your application. Quality certifications such as ISO 9001 or industry-specific standards may be important depending on your sector. Lead times can vary, so plan purchases accordingly. For large volume orders, consider establishing long-term supply agreements with manufacturers to ensure consistent quality and potentially better pricing.
